Garmin Extends ADS-B Aircraft List
Garmin International now offers ADS-B installations and upgrades for a wide range of business aircraft through its network.

Garmin has added to the list of aircraft that can be upgraded to ADS-B through its authorized dealer network. The aircraft/authorized dealer combinations available can be obtained from the company. Several configurations are available, optimized for each individual aircraft type, Garmin said.


For non-Tcas II aircraft, the GTX 345R/GTX 335R ADS-B transponders provide operators with an all-in-one remote-mount installation and offer the option ofWaas-GPS. The latter model also receives ADS-B IN traffic and weather, GPS position data and back-up attitude information for display on the Garmin Pilot and ForeFlight Mobile apps.


For Tcas II-equipped aircraft, Garmin said operators can use the GDL 88 ADS-B datalink and GTX-3000 mode-S extended-squitter transponder “to economically achieve ADS-B requirements.” The GTX 3000 “leverages the GDL 88’s internal WAAS/SBAS receiver" to broadcast aircraft identity, state and intent information (DO-260B compliant) to ATC, while also providing operators with a Waas position source.


On certain aircraft Garmin’s Flight Stream wireless datalink can be added to give pilots wireless access to FIS-B weather and traffic on approved mobile devices in the cockpit.
